The RSA General Guide to K-12 Course of Study
Academic levels have been grouped below into multi-year ranges, to accommodate regional differences in the order of study of the various topics below. Students are not restricted by age, and may post scholastic projects in topics above or below their current grade.
As in any school, the teacher’s educational approach may take precedence over the list below. Variation in high school studies (e.g., “electives” throughout grades 8 or 9 through 12) are also expected. For purposes of comparison and reference, a linked list of specific regional educational standards are available at right.
Regardless, a significant number of projects are encouraged, which indicate both quantitative and qualitative understanding, and which demonstrate mastery of major topics within each Subject area. These can be posted on Show and Know, if desired by teacher and student. Cum laude honors may be awarded to students who have shown outstanding accomplishments in their studies and projects.
Again, as in any school, the students and teachers themselves bear ultimate responsibility to make the most of their educational opportunities.
